Porsche 911 Safety & Reliability
Federal safety data shows 4 recalls and 0 complaints for the 2023 Porsche 911, a low safety profile overall. Check the known issues section below for the most common problem areas.
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2022-2023 911 vehicles. In the event of a crash with passenger air bag deployment, the dashboard console may break, causing the air bag to deploy improperly.
An improper air bag deployment increases the risk of injury in a crash.
View at NHTSAPors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2020-2024 911 vehicles. The front windshield and rear window may not be properly secured and can detach.
During air bag deployment, an unsecured windshield may not support the front air bags as intended, increasing the risk of injury in a crash.
View at NHTSAPors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2025 Panamera, 2024 718 Cayman GT4 RS, 718 Spyder RS, and 2021-2024 911 vehicles. The center lock wheel bolt may fracture and cause the wheel to detach.
Wheel detachment can result in a loss of vehicle control, increasing the risk of a crash.

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2023 911 vehicles. The bolts for the rear seat belt buckles may not be tightened properly.
A loose seat belt buckle may not properly restrain an occupant during a crash, increasing the risk of injury.

Porsche 911 Fuel Economy
The 2023 Porsche 911 delivers 19 to 21 MPG combined across 20 powertrain combinations. If fuel cost matters to you, pay attention to engine and drivetrain. The spread is significant.
